About “Louis Lambert”
Louis Lambert is an 1832 novel by Honoré de Balzac, part of the Études philosophiques section of his larger work La Comédie humaine. The story takes place mostly in a school in Vendôme and follows a young genius who is deeply interested in the ideas of the Swedish philosopher Emanuel Swedenborg. The novel explores the character's thoughts and beliefs, focusing on his intellectual development and philosophical interests. Balzac uses the character of Louis Lambert to examine themes of knowledge, spirituality, and the nature of genius. (Summary adapted from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.)
